| Aspect | Filler Machine Operator | Packaging Technician |
|---|
| Credentials | High school diploma, on-the-job training | High school diploma, certification often preferred |
| Work Environment | Manufacturing or production line, operating filling machines | Packaging line, preparing and sealing products |
| Industry Usage | Food, beverage, cosmetics, pharmaceuticals | Food, beverage, consumer goods |
| Job Focus | Operating and maintaining filling machinery | Assembling, sealing, and labeling packaged products |
While both roles are essential in manufacturing, the Filler Machine Operator primarily focuses on operating filling equipment, whereas the Packaging Technician handles packaging processes. Both roles require attention to detail and safety protocols, but their specific tasks differ within the production line.
